     39 /**
     40  * Task that monitors the control stream from the host and updates
     41  * the trace status according to commands received from the host.
     42  */
     43 static void *commandReceiveTask(void *arg) {
     44     GLTraceState *state = (GLTraceState *)arg;
     45     TCPStream *stream = state->getStream();
     46 
     47     // The control stream always receives an integer size of the
     48     // command buffer, followed by the actual command buffer.
     49     uint32_t cmdSize;
     50 
     51     // Command Buffer
     52     void *cmdBuf = NULL;
     53     uint32_t cmdBufSize = 0;
     54 
     55     enum TraceSettingsMasks {
     56         READ_FB_ON_EGLSWAP_MASK = 1 << 0,
     57         READ_FB_ON_GLDRAW_MASK = 1 << 1,
     58         READ_TEXTURE_DATA_ON_GLTEXIMAGE_MASK = 1 << 2,
     59     };
     60 
     61     while (true) {
     62         // read command size
     63         if (stream->receive(&cmdSize, sizeof(uint32_t)) < 0) {
     64             break;
     65         }
     66         cmdSize = ntohl(cmdSize);
     67 
     68         // ensure command buffer is of required size
     69         if (cmdBufSize < cmdSize) {
     70             free(cmdBuf);
     71             cmdBufSize = cmdSize;
     72             cmdBuf = malloc(cmdSize);
     73             if (cmdBuf == NULL)
     74                 break;
     75         }
     76 
     77         // receive the command
     78         if (stream->receive(cmdBuf, cmdSize) < 0) {
     79             break;
     80         }
     81 
     82         if (cmdSize != sizeof(uint32_t)) {
     83             // Currently, we only support commands that are a single integer,
     84             // so we skip all other commands
     85             continue;
     86         }
     87 
     88         uint32_t cmd = ntohl(*(uint32_t*)cmdBuf);
     89 
     90         bool collectFbOnEglSwap = (cmd & READ_FB_ON_EGLSWAP_MASK) != 0;
     91         bool collectFbOnGlDraw = (cmd & READ_FB_ON_GLDRAW_MASK) != 0;
     92         bool collectTextureData = (cmd & READ_TEXTURE_DATA_ON_GLTEXIMAGE_MASK) != 0;
     93 
     94         state->setCollectFbOnEglSwap(collectFbOnEglSwap);
     95         state->setCollectFbOnGlDraw(collectFbOnGlDraw);
     96         state->setCollectTextureDataOnGlTexImage(collectTextureData);
     97 
     98         ALOGD("trace options: eglswap: %d, gldraw: %d, texImage: %d",
     99             collectFbOnEglSwap, collectFbOnGlDraw, collectTextureData);
    100     }
    101 
    102     ALOGE("Stopping OpenGL Trace Command Receiver\n");
    103 
    104     free(cmdBuf);
    105     return NULL;
    106 }

    108 void GLTrace_start() {
    109     char udsName[PROPERTY_VALUE_MAX];
    110 
    111     property_get("debug.egl.debug_portname", udsName, "gltrace");
    112     int clientSocket = gltrace::acceptClientConnection(udsName);
    113     if (clientSocket < 0) {
    114         ALOGE("Error creating GLTrace server socket. Quitting application.");
    115         exit(-1);
    116     }
    117 
    118     // create communication channel to the host
    119     TCPStream *stream = new TCPStream(clientSocket);
    120 
    121     // initialize tracing state
    122     sGLTraceState = new GLTraceState(stream);
    123 
    124     pthread_create(&sReceiveThreadId, NULL, commandReceiveTask, sGLTraceState);
    125 }
